Punjab starts vaccination drive for protesting farmers at Tikri

Punjab starts vaccination drive for protesting farmers at Tikri


Chandigarh, July 6

The state health department today started a vaccination drive for farmers protesting at the Delhi borders for the past over seven months.

A team of the department, including Mohali Civil Hospital Senior Medical Officer Dr Harminderjit Singh Cheema and community health officer Dr Manpreet Singh, was formed following the orders of the DC and the civil surgeon. The first dose was administered to Avtar Singh Sursing. — TNS
